Output 32a3f1889b7b28a96a60f5577a98d1244f087a40ad038c6e92f6903ba0397c6a:19

value
8806
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5bc6a1878bac09aa2edd1158e17d4a2ef2bf3466dcf02f768bb6712cc2646f53
address
bc1pt0r2rput4sy65tkaz9vwzl229met7drxmncz7a5tkecjesnydafs5fpmur
transaction
32a3f1889b7b28a96a60f5577a98d1244f087a40ad038c6e92f6903ba0397c6a
spent
true